Pin Header SMD Sandwich 1,00 mm
Rated current
1,0 A
Rated voltage
50 V
RMS
/ V
DC
Withstand voltage
250 V
RMS
for one minute
Material contact
Copper alloy
Material insulator
High temp. thermoplast UL94V-0
Operating temperature -40°C to +105°C
Max. processing temper. 260°C for 10 seconds
